See artikkel on masintõlke peegelartikkel, palun klõpsake siia, et hüpata algse artikli juurde.

Vaade: 33559|Vastuse: 1

[Allikas] Kasuta MySQL-i, et automaatselt ajastada varukoopiaid Windowsi keskkonnas

[Kopeeri link]
Postitatud 12.04.2019 11:46:40 | | | |
1. Kirjuta varukoopia skript

See on väga levinud Windowsi partiiskriptifail ja selgitan lühidalt peamisi osi:

Forfiles kasutatakse aegunud varukoopiate kustutamiseks varunduskataloogist. "E:\mysql\MySQL BackUp" on tee, kus asub varukoopiafail, mida saad ise muuta. backup_*.sql viitab kõigile andmebaasi varundusfailidele, mis algavad tähega "backup_" ja millele on lisatud ".sql". Number "30" pärast tähistab 30-päevast aegumiskuupäeva.

Kasuta set-käsku, et defineerida muutuja nimega "Ymd", ja selle muutuja väärtus on suur reeglite kogum, lihtsustatult öeldes praegune kuupäev ja kellaaeg
See käsurida kutsub välja MySQL-iga kaasas oleva varundustööriista, pane tähele, et see tee peab olema kirjutatud teeks, kus asub sinu enda "mysqldump.exe", tavaliselt MySQL paigaldustee /bin kaustas. Sellele käsureale järgneb pikk nimekiri parameetritest, valime mõned olulised parameetrid, mida selgitada:

MySQL andmebaasiteenusega ühendatud kontodel peab olema õigus andmebaasi varundustoimingute tegemiseks. Lihtsuse huvides kasutame rooti, kuid ei soovitata root-kontosid tegelikus tootmiskeskkonnas, et vältida konto ja paroolide lekkimist, mis tekitab tarbetuid probleeme.
See on parool MySQL andmebaasiteenusega ühenduse loomiseks
See on serveri IP-aadress, kus andmebaasiteenus asub
See on serveri pordinumber, kus andmebaasiteenus asub
sündmuste parameeter, et varundada andmebaasi kindlasse faili. "yumi_website" on andmebaas, mida tuleb varundada, ja sildi ">" paremal küljel on serveri kataloog ja failinimi, kuhu meie varukoopia salvestatakse.

2. Sea Windowsi ülesanded

Kui oleme eelnevad sammud lõpetanud, peame lisama Windowsi ajastatud ülesande.

Windows Server 2008-s läheme serveri halduspaneelile, klõpsame paremas ülanurgas menüüribal "Tööriistad" ja valime seal "Task Scheduler":




Pärast ülesannete ajastaja avamist klõpsame paremal "Loo põhiülesanne":



Seejärel tuleb täita ülesande nimi ja kirjeldus:



Pärast järgmisena klõpsamist peame määrama ülesande sageduse ja valisin "Igapäevane":



Klõpsa uuesti "Järgmine", määra ülesande täitmise aeg, valisin kell 1 keset ööd:



Valikus "Järgmine" valime "Käivita programm":



Järgmises dialoogis peame valima just kirjutatud partiifaili:



Kui need sammud on tehtud, annab Windows meile ülevaate kogu ülesandest:



Kui oled kindel, klõpsa "Valmis". Sel hetkel näeme, et Windowsi ülesannete nimekirjas on uus ülesanne:



Praeguseks on MySQL-i automaatne varundamine Windowsi keskkonnas täielikult paigas.




Eelmine:Java määrab, kas klass pärib vanemklassi
Järgmine:asp.net GridView genereerib dünaamiliselt veerge
 Üürileandja| Postitatud 30.09.2021 11:30:51 |
CMD bat standardiseerib mitmeid meetodeid praeguse süsteemi kuupäeva saamiseks ja lisab 0
https://www.itsvse.com/thread-9673-1-1.html
Disclaimer:
Kõik Code Farmer Networki poolt avaldatud tarkvara, programmeerimismaterjalid või artiklid on mõeldud ainult õppimiseks ja uurimistööks; Ülaltoodud sisu ei tohi kasutada ärilistel ega ebaseaduslikel eesmärkidel, vastasel juhul kannavad kasutajad kõik tagajärjed. Selle saidi info pärineb internetist ning autoriõiguste vaidlused ei ole selle saidiga seotud. Ülaltoodud sisu tuleb oma arvutist täielikult kustutada 24 tunni jooksul pärast allalaadimist. Kui sulle programm meeldib, palun toeta originaaltarkvara, osta registreerimist ja saa paremaid ehtsaid teenuseid. Kui esineb rikkumist, palun võtke meiega ühendust e-posti teel.

Mail To:help@itsvse.com